Output 8a67ab973e93b450c3dfd00e90bd2891d1945eae4b3cdf5ba0184695e4af718e:1

value
34488485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5a931e973b6be4073d8af78da22f36e37cdecf OP_EQUAL
address
3D2YDa2RLpR9ewuN82CxxSWUF8kQxigx1r
transaction
8a67ab973e93b450c3dfd00e90bd2891d1945eae4b3cdf5ba0184695e4af718e
confirmations
394079
spent
true